What is the impact of integrating AI into the EOS Process Component for operational efficiency and exit value?

Integrating AI into the EOS Process Component revolutionizes operational efficiency and significantly enhances exit value. The Process Component in EOS emphasizes documenting and following the 'right way' to do things, ensuring consistency and scalability. When AI is applied here, it takes this to an entirely new level.

First, AI can analyze existing processes for bottlenecks, inefficiencies, and areas of redundancy that might not be obvious to human observation. For example, machine learning algorithms can review operational data streams from various departments, identifying patterns and predicting potential failure points in workflows. This allows for proactive optimization, leading to smoother operations and reduced waste, directly impacting the bottom line.

Second, AI automates repetitive tasks within these processes. This frees up valuable human capital, allowing employees to focus on higher value, strategic activities aligned with the company's vision and exit goals. Think about automated data entry, report generation, or initial customer support interactions, all contributing to a lean, efficient operation.

Third, AI provides real time performance monitoring against documented processes. It can flag deviations, suggest corrective actions, and even predict future performance based on current trends. This level of continuous improvement and control is highly attractive to potential acquirers, as it demonstrates a sophisticated, data driven, and scalable operational foundation. Such well oiled, AI enhanced processes significantly de risk the business, proving its ability to run predictably and profitably without heavy owner intervention, thereby boosting its attractiveness and valuation for exit.
